Digital safety- critical oil and gas training

-

A digital transforma­tion of oil and gas safetycrit­ical emergency response training is set to save the industry more than a million hours of training time per year, driving time and cost efficienci­es across the sector, a gathering of world-wide industry leaders were told at the eighth annual OSCC and exhibition, in Kuala Lumpur last month.

OPITO, the global, not-for- profit skills body for the energy industry, today launched the digital delivery of the Basic Offshore Safety Induction and Emergency Training (BOSIET) at the conference, addressing the sector’s call for regulated online learning with world- class credibilit­y that delivers efficienci­es.

With over 150,000 people undertakin­g the three- day primary emergency response BOSIET training in the last year, the online option will now be offered alongside the practical element as an alternativ­e to classroom- based learning. The online modules are completed remotely at a learner’s own pace and location. With only one day required for the practical training, it offers the potential to give more than a million hours of training time each year back to industry and reduce travel and accommodat­ion costs.

The training is said to be widely regarded in the industry as the ‘must have’ certificat­ion to enable a worker to go offshore and includes helicopter survival, emergency first aid, sea survival, fire-fighting and lifeboat training.

OPITO standards have been adopted by major internatio­nal and national oil and gas companies in over 45 countries. The digital delivery of BOSIET is a long-term, demand led initiative to create a change in workforce training through innovation. The skills body has worked with digital partner Atlas Knowledge on behalf of industry to develop the interactiv­e training featuring video and animations.

The online training includes the three standards in the suite, Emergency Breathing System (EBS), Compressed Air Emergency Breathing System (CA-EBS) and Tropical BOSIET. It is available on all devices including smart phones, desktops, laptops and tablets.

It is available to learners anytime and anywhere in the world where they can access the internet. It enhances safety- critical knowledge through online assessment before progressin­g to the final verificati­on and practical day at an OPITO approved training centre.
